Any bank holding company which controls a Mississippi bank or a Mississippi bank holding company shall be subject to such laws of this state and such rules of its agencies relating to the acquisition, ownership and operation of banks and bank holding companies as are applicable to Mississippi bank holding companies. Any Mississippi bank which is controlled by a bank holding company that is not a Mississippi bank holding company shall be subject to all laws of this state and rules and regulations of its agencies relating to the acquisition, ownership, operation and regulation of banks and their branches as are applicable to Mississippi banks which are not controlled by such non-Mississippi bank holding companies and may establish branches pursuant to Chapter 7 of this title.
